About the department

The Cloudflare Research team stands at the nexus of academic inquiry and real-world implementation, operating with a clear mandate: to advance the company's mission to help build a better Internet. We translate public values into tangible, globally-scaled technologies, ensuring the Internet remains secure, private, and accessible.

Cloudflare Research is unique because we don’t just publish papers; we build the protocols and systems that power a significant portion of the web. Our current focus areas include Artificial Intelligence, Cryptography, Privacy, Network Protocols, Measurement and Performance Evaluation, and Distributed Systems. What Makes Cloudflare Special?

We’re not just a highly ambitious, large-scale technology company. We’re a highly ambitious, large-scale technology company with a soul. Fundamental to our mission to help build a better Internet is protecting the free and open Internet.

Project Galileo: Since 2014, we've equipped more than 2,400 journalism and civil society organizations in 111 countries with powerful tools to defend themselves against attacks that would otherwise censor their work, technology already used by Cloudflare’s enterprise customers--at no cost.

Athenian Project: In 2017, we created the Athenian Project to ensure that state and local governments have the highest level of protection and reliability for free, so that their constituents have access to election information and voter registration. Since the project, we've provided services to more than 425 local government election websites in 33 states.

1.1.1.1: We released 1.1.1.1 to help fix the foundation of the Internet by building a faster, more secure and privacy-centric public DNS resolver. This is available publicly for everyone to use - it is the first consumer-focused service Cloudflare has ever released. Here’s the deal - we don’t store client IP addresses never, ever. We will continue to abide by our privacy commitment and ensure that no user data is sold to advertisers or used to target consumers.
